Healing Through Connection: Nyibol Racheal’s Mission to Transform Refugee Mental Health

Nyibol Racheal’s Refugee Mental Health Network is transforming mental health and support for refugees and vulnerable communities by blending culturally-informed care with personalized approaches. Drawing from her experience as a refugee, Racheal offers one-on-one interviews and counseling sessions where trauma survivors can share their stories in a compassionate, judgment-free space. These personal interactions often mark the beginning of a transformative healing process, allowing individuals to confront and process their trauma.

Racheal’s initiative also incorporates creative therapies, including art, storytelling, and community theater, which provide additional outlets for expression and collective healing. Through this holistic approach, Racheal’s work empowers individuals to reclaim their narratives and rebuild their lives, demonstrating the profound impact of empathy, connection, and culturally attuned care.
